Is the blurring problem less severe when using a 300 Hz tone which is my favourite? At 300Hz the differences in audio frequency seem to be more noticeable. This is personal but I find the tone less harsh and in my case the RX equalization is set to favour a narrow band of frequencies around 300 Hz. When this problem occurs for me I wait for the pile up to die down and one or two stations to come back or persist.
